- Home
- Programmes
- Computer Science & IT
3.0k Short courses in Computer Science & IT

Agentic AI
Designed for tech, data and product professionals looking to build technical expertise in Agentic AI with the Agentic AI course from Johns Hopkins University. Develop the skills to design, build and deploy production-grade autonomous AI Agents and multi-agent systems. Earn a Certificate of Completion from Johns Hopkins University.

Physics Summer School
The Physics Summer School course at Imperial is led by Professor David Colling and Dr Alexander Richards from Imperial’s Department of Physics.

AI-Native Professional - Workflows and Agents for Productivity
The AI-Native Professional - Workflows and Agents for Productivity programme from Great Learning will help you ship a portfolio of working tools: multi- step automations, custom agents, and end-to-end content pipelines you'll keep using long after the program ends.

IT (Web Design) - UK
Want to enter a fast-paced, growing profession that lets you showcase your technical and creative skills? Take the next step in your career with the online IT (Web Design) - UK courses from International Career Institute (ICI) - UK. These flexible learning programmes will equip you with the skills you need to thrive in this dynamic industry.

IT (Web Design)
Want to enter a fast-paced, growing profession that lets you showcase your technical and creative skills? Take the next step in your career with the IT (Web Design) course from International Career Institute (ICI). These flexible learning programmes will equip you with the skills you need to thrive in this dynamic industry.

IT (Web Design) - USA
Want to enter a fast-paced, growing profession that lets you showcase your technical and creative skills? Take the next step in your career with the online IT (Web Design) - USA courses. These flexible learning programme from International Career Institute (ICI) - USA will equip you with the skills you need to thrive in this dynamic industry.

Data Analytics Essentials
Developed by a leading university, this Data Analytics Essentials course of the data analytics essentials course covers foundational concepts and major skills and tools required to excel as a data analyst.

Applied AI
The Applied AI course from Johns Hopkins University will help you build practical skills in applied AI, machine learning, deep learning, and generative AI to extract insights, solve business problems, and deploy real-world solutions.

Cybersecurity
Go from beginner to expert in 24 Weeks. Master in-demand skills through hands-on labs where you'll hack, defend, and secure systems using industry-standard tools with this Cybersecurity programme from Johns Hopkins University.

AI in Healthcare
Explore how AI is enhancing healthcare systems, aiming to improve patient care and operational efficiency with this AI in Healthcare programme from John Hopkins University.

Pre-university - Using Data in the Sciences
The Pre-university - Using Data in the Sciences programme at The University of Edinburgh is specifically designed for 16-18 year olds in their final or penultimate year of school who are considering pursuing an undergraduate degree in Science, Technology, Engineering and Maths (STEM).

Dynamic Malware Analysis using LLMs (Internship)
The Dynamic Malware Analysis using LLMs (Internship) project from King Abdullah University of Science and Technology (KAUST) covers the increasing complexity of malware highlights the need for advanced analysis tools, both static and dynamic, for effective reverse engineering and behavioral analysis of a given sample.

Data Streaming Nanodegree
Learn the latest skills to process data in real-time by building fluency in modern data engineering tools, such as Apache Spark, Kafka, Spark Streaming, and Kafka Streaming. The Data Streaming Nanodegree program is offered by Udacity.

Efficient Pricing of High-Dimensional (multi-assets) European Options (Internship)
The student of the Efficient Pricing of High-Dimensional (multi-assets) European Options (Internship) project from King Abdullah University of Science and Technology (KAUST) will work on designing new numerical methods based on hierarchical adaptive sparse grids quadratures combined with Fourier techniques for efficient pricing of high-dimensional (multi-assets) European Options.

Egocentric Video Understanding (Internship)
The Egocentric Video Understanding (Internship) project at King Abdullah University of Science and Technology (KAUST) refers to videos recorded from the first-person point of view, with the camera mounted on the head (e.g., GoPro) or smart glasses worn alongside the eyes (e.g., Google glasses), and they are what you actually see in your eyes.

Professional Certificate of Competency of Data Engineering Foundations
This Professional Certificate of Competency of Data Engineering Foundations from the Engineering Institute of Technology equips engineers and technicians with the essential skills needed to excel in data engineering.

Tertiary Preparation Programme (Health Sciences)
The Tertiary Preparation Programme (Health Sciences) programme at the Australian Catholic University (ACU) is for international students who want to pursue academic studies in health sciences.

Professional Certificate of Competency in Safety Instrumentation Systems for Process Industries
This Professional Certificate of Competency in Safety Instrumentation Systems for Process Industries from the Engineering Institute of Technology is designed for engineers and technicians who wish to develop their knowledge of the design and implementation of safety instrumented systems as applied to industrial processes.

Scaling Graph Neural Networks to 1000s of GPUs (Internship)
This Scaling Graph Neural Networks to 1000s of GPUs (Internship) project from King Abdullah University of Science and Technology (KAUST) is to scale GNN training to thousands of GPUs. We will target our new supercomputer, Shaheen III, which is projected to include 2800 Nvidia Hopper super-chips than combine a CPU with a H100 GPU.

Topics in Machine Learning and Optimization (Internship)
The Topics in Machine Learning and Optimization (Internship) project is offered at King Abdullah University of Science and Technology (KAUST)